background image

Using the AT85DVK-07 Board

AT85DVK-07 Development Board User Guide

2-11

4391B–MP3–07/07

Figure 2-9.  

Parallel Remote Control Unit Implementation

Table 2-9.  

Remote Control Connector (J11)

Pin Number

Pin Name

Pin Description

1

VDD 

IOVDD power supply 1.8V or 3V depending on the power configuration

2

BLVDD

Controlled HVDD for back-light usage (LCD extension)

3

P3.0/RXD/MISO

UART Receive Serial Data
SPI Master Input Slave Output Data Line

4

P1.7

General purpose I/O or back-light control (LCD extension)

5

P3.1/TXD/MOSI

UART Transmit Serial Data
SPI Master Output Slave Input Data Line

6

nRST

Chip Reset (optional through SE30 solder strap)

7

P3.2/INT0/RTS/SCK

External Interrupt 0
UART Request To Send Control Line
SPI Clock Line

8

P5.1/SCS/LCS

PSI Slave Chip Select
LCD Chip Select

9

P3.3/INT1/CTS/SS

External Interrupt 1
UART Clear To Send Control Line
SPI Slave Select Line

10

P5.2/SA0/LA0/LRS

PSI Slave Address Bit 0
LCD Address Bit 0 (8080) Register Select Signal (6800)

11

VSS

0V digital supply reference

12

P5.3/SWR/LWR/LRW

PSI Slave Write Signal
LCD Write Signal (8080) Read/Write Signal (6800)

13

VSS

0V digital supply reference

14

P5.0/SRD/LRD/LDE

PSI Slave Write Signal
LCD Read Signal (8080) Enable Signal (6800)

15

VSS

0V digital supply reference

16

P0.0/SD0/LD0

PSI Slave Data Bit 0
LCD Data Bit 0

17

VSS

0V digital supply reference

18

P0.1/SD1/LD1

PSI Slave Data Bit 1
LCD Data Bit 1

19

VSS

0V digital supply reference

20

P0.2/SD2/LD2

PSI Slave Data Bit 2
LCD Data Bit 2

21

VSS

0V digital supply reference

22

P0.3/SD3/LD3

PSI Slave Data Bit 3
LCD Data Bit 3

23

P0.5/SD5/LD5

PSI Slave Data Bit 5
LCD Data Bit 5

J11

1

2

25

26

Summary of Contents for AT85DVK-07

Page 1: ...AT85DVK 07 Development Board Hardware User s Guide ...

Page 2: ...upply 2 7 2 2 4 Power Configuration 2 8 2 2 5 External DC DC Replacement 2 9 2 3 Microcontroller Unit 2 9 2 3 1 Socket 2 10 2 3 2 Reset 2 10 2 3 3 In System Programming 2 10 2 4 Remote Control Unit 2 10 2 4 1 Serial Remote Unit 2 10 2 4 2 Parallel Remote Unit 2 10 2 5 USB Unit 2 12 2 5 1 OTG Extension 2 12 2 6 Nand Flash Unit 2 12 2 6 1 Nand Flash Extension 2 13 2 6 2 On Board Nand Flash Configura...

Page 3: ...e Connection 2 20 2 16 Nand Flash Board Extension 2 21 Section 3 Technical Specifications 3 23 Section 4 Development Board Errata List 4 25 4 1 Board V1 0 0 4 25 4 2 Board V1 0 1 4 25 Section 5 Technical Support 5 27 5 1 Problem Reporting 5 27 5 2 Firmware 5 27 5 3 Hardware 5 27 5 4 Tools 5 28 5 5 Audio Player 5 28 5 6 Picture Viewer 5 28 ...

Page 4: ...umerous inter faces USB PSI RS232 SPI and on board resources keyboard 128x64 graphic LCD This user s guide acts as a general getting started guide as well as a complete technical reference for advanced users 1 1 1 Typical Applications MP3 WMA Audio Player PDA Camera Mobile Phone Audio Player Car Audio Multimedia Audio Player Home Audio Multimedia Audio Player Karaoke 1 2 AT85DVK 07 Starter Kit Con...

Page 5: ... Starter Kit Information The AT85DVK 07 Starter Kit allows demonstrating of 2 typical applications which differ entiate by the power supply voltage The Very Low Voltage System The player operates at 1 8V and allows very low power consumption The Low Voltage System The player operates at 3V and allows low power consumption ...

Page 6: ...w Voltage 1 8V System Figure 1 2 Typical Very Low Voltage 1 8V Application 1 3 2 Low Voltage 3V System Figure 1 3 Typical Low Voltage 3V Application 1 8V NF Memories PA SD MMC LCD Battery FM Module AT85C51SND3Bx LVDD 3V NF Memories SD MMC LCD 3V DC DC Battery FM Module AT85C51SND3Bx HVDD ...

Page 7: ... AT85DVK 07 Board can be used as a stand alone USB mass storage disk and master or slave multi format audio player 2 1 Development Board Figure 2 1 AT85DVK 07 Board Block Diagram PSI Nand Flash OCD Audio Display Keypad Management AT85C51SND3Bx Power MMC SD In Out USB FS HS UART SPI FM Board AT85DVK 07 ...

Page 8: ...07 Board On Chip Serial ISP FM Extension Audio Input Output Mic AT89C51SND3Bx USB Line In Display Int DAC DAC Ext MMC SD Nand Flash Keypad Power Management Debug J32 J31 J13 J14 J11 J10 J9 J25 J20 J23 J26 J1 J2 J3 J7 J8 J24 J22 J36 J37 J19 J30 J28 J5 Parallel J43 RST VSS J38 J39 J42 AT85DVK 07 Remote Remote ...

Page 9: ...te without battery during firmware development process the AT85DVK 07 Board provides an external power supply input through connector J20 Notes 1 Remove any plugged battery from the socket before applying the external voltage 2 The external power supply input is not protected against polarization inversion Table 2 2 External Power Supply Connector Pinout J20 Table 2 3 External Power Supply Range F...

Page 10: ...er Configuration Notes 1 Option to allow battery voltage monitoring by the AT85C51SND3Bx 2 Option to allow power key press detection by the AT85C51SND3Bx 3 Remove this connection when using a daughter board DC DC extension Figure 2 5 Very Low Voltage Application Power Configuration Solder Strap Very Low Voltage Application Low Voltage Application Comment SE32 X VDD selection amongst HVDD or LVDD S...

Page 11: ...Low Voltage mode and SE38 along with SE56 must be open Table 2 6 External DC DC Extension Connector J19 Table 2 7 External DC DC Extension Connector J22 2 3 Microcontroller Unit The Microcontroller unit consists in the AT85C51SND3Bx component in LQFP100 pin package including its 12 MHz oscillator and the reset RST and in system programming ISP push buttons SE35 AAA Battery SE33 SE32 SE34 SE56 SE57...

Page 12: ... audio player remotely Note The AT85DVK 07 Board is supplied without any RS 232 driver receiver Figure 2 8 Serial Remote Control Unit Implementation Table 2 8 Remote Control Connector J23 2 4 2 Parallel Remote Unit The Parallel Remote Control unit implements a 26 pin connector J11 sharing the PSI 8 bit Parallel Slave Interface UART and high speed SPI Interfaces This connector allows easy connectio...

Page 13: ... Clock Line 8 P5 1 SCS LCS PSI Slave Chip Select LCD Chip Select 9 P3 3 INT1 CTS SS External Interrupt 1 UART Clear To Send Control Line SPI Slave Select Line 10 P5 2 SA0 LA0 LRS PSI Slave Address Bit 0 LCD Address Bit 0 8080 Register Select Signal 6800 11 VSS 0V digital supply reference 12 P5 3 SWR LWR LRW PSI Slave Write Signal LCD Write Signal 8080 Read Write Signal 6800 13 VSS 0V digital suppl...

Page 14: ... Nand Flash Unit The Nand Flash unit consists in a standard nand flash memory foot print allowing user to solder its own nand flash memory and 2 extension connectors J13 J14 allowing inser tion of a 2x NF daughter board or a 4x NF daughter board supporting up to 2 or 4 nand flash memories A 4x nand flash daughter board equipped with 1 memory along with a bare PCB see Section 2 16 is delivered insi...

Page 15: ...h 2 Chip Enable SmartMediaCard xD Picture Card Insertion Signal 4 NFWP Write Protect Signal 5 VDD IOVDD power supply 1 8V or 3V depending on the power configuration 6 NFCLE Command Latch Enable Signal 7 NFALE Address Latch Enable Signal 8 NC Not Used 9 NFCE0 Nand Flash 0 Chip Enable 10 NC Not Used 11 NFCE1 SMLCK Nand Flash 1 Chip Enable SmartMediaCard xD Picture Card Write Lock Signal 12 NFRE Read...

Page 16: ...ny conflict with a nand flash daughter board that may be plugged in When no nand flash memory is soldered solder straps may be left opened Figure 2 13 Nand Flash Configuration bottom view 2 7 MMC SD Unit The MMC SD unit consists in a single card socket that allows direct plug in of MMC RS MMC and SD cards 11 NFD1 Data Bit 1 12 NFD0 Data Bit 0 13 VSS 0V digital supply reference Pin Number Pin Name ...

Page 17: ...MC SD I O Extension Connector J32 2 8 Audio Input Unit The Audio Input unit consists in the electret microphone unit and a 3 5mm stereo input jack J3 J32 J31 J28 P2 P2 MMC SD Pin Number Pin Name Pin Description 1 P2 0 SDINS SD MMC Card Insertion Signal 2 P2 1 SDLCK SD Card Write Lock Signal 3 P2 2 SDCMD SD MMC Command Line 4 P2 3 SDCLK SD MMC Clock 5 P2 4 SDDAT0 SD MMC Data Line 0 Pin Number Pin N...

Page 18: ...SE1 SE2 SE19 SE18 SE51 for external headphone amplifier and SE49 SE50 for external audio DAC must be left opened to avoid short circuits Note On board DAC and on chip DAC audio codec usage is exclusive User s selection can be configured in the audio firmware driver for further information refer to the firmware user s manual Figure 2 16 Audio Output Unit Implementation Table 2 15 Headphone Amplifie...

Page 19: ...l output 9 AVSS 0V analog supply reference 10 NC Pin Number Pin Name Pin Description 1 VDD IOVDD power supply 1 8V or 3V depending on the power configuration 2 DAC_I0 DAC control bit 0 3 DAC_I1 DAC control bit 1 4 DAC_I2 DAC control bit 2 5 DAC_I3 DAC control bit 3 6 DAC_nRST Active low DAC reset signal 7 DAC_OCLK DAC oversampling clock 8 DAC_DCLK DAC data clock 9 DAC_DDAT DAC data line 10 DAC_DSE...

Page 20: ...g a 4 direction mini joystick and power on key along with 2 extension connectors J10 J30 allow user to plug a daugh ter board featuring particular keys like 2 direction mini joystick rolling wheel Note To ease software implementation with generic software keypad driver user s keypad arrangement must fit with an available matrix configuration for further information refer to the firmware user s man...

Page 21: ...ing Table 2 22 6 pin OCD Connector J26 Pin Number Pin Name Pin Description 1 VDD IOVDD power supply 1 8V or 3V depending on the power configuration 2 P1 4 General purpose I O used for matrix row 3 P1 3 KIN3 General purpose I O used for matrix row or matrix column 3 input 1 4 P1 2 KIN2 General purpose I O used for matrix row or matrix column 2 input 1 5 P1 5 General purpose I O used for matrix row ...

Page 22: ...AT85C51SND3Bx LVDD power supply The AT85C51SND3Bx LIDD power consumption can be monitored using this jumper J39 This jumper allows insertion of a ammeter on board VDD power supply LVDD or HVDD depending on power configuration The NF MMC LCD power consumption can be monitored using this jumper Note In order to remove non significant consumption linked to the led power supply HVDD remove SE31 solder...

Page 23: ...can be configured for operation with sin gle CE or double CE Nand Flash memories double dies per package Figure 2 22 shows the board implementation while Table 2 23 and Table 2 24 summa rize the board configuration depending on Nand Flash memory type Note In order to fit with generic software driver the Nand Flash memories soldered on one board must be of same part number Figure 2 22 Nand Flash Bo...

Page 24: ...r straps connect pin 6 TSOP package of selected NF to VSS check Nand Flash datasheet Table 2 24 Double CE Nand Flash Memory Configuration Numberof NF Populated Footprint Solder Strap Configuration NF0 NF1 NF2 NF3 SE0 1 SE1 1 SE2 1 SE3 1 SE4 SE5 SE6 SE7 x1 X X x2 X X X X x4 X X X X X X X X Numberof NF Populated Footprint Solder Strap Configuration NF0 NF1 NF2 NF3 SE0 SE1 SE2 SE3 SE4 SE5 SE6 SE7 x1 ...

Page 25: ...23 4391B MP3 07 07 Section 3 Technical Specifications System Unit Physical Dimensions L 120 x W 120 x H 25 mm Weight 100 g Operating Conditions Voltage Supply 1 5V single battery element or USB VBUS or external power supply battery replacement ...

Page 26: ... input Workaround Add 1uF capacitor between microphone and MICIN input layout cut External DAC Conflict Using SPI SIO Interface External DAC being controlled by the SPI SIO lines SPI or SIO transfers are disturbed by the SPI_DOUT line when SPI_CSB line is asserted Workaround Insulate SPI DAC control lines layout cut LCD Display Stability 1 8V The display shows flickering when operating 1 8V LCD ch...

Page 27: ... Name Short Description Example COMPANY AT85C51SND3B2 Audio File Stop Playing Note For follow up reason report problems separately i e one problem per report Problem Description Give a detailed description of your problem 5 2 Firmware Send your complete firmware project unless it is strictly confidential Package Base Name e g snd3b refd1 1_0_33 Any useful information about changes 5 3 Hardware Sil...

Page 28: ...iguration e g On board DC DC Operating Voltage e g 3V Any useful information about configuration Note In order to be able to reproduce and investigate the problem in our laboratory be ready to send to send schematic bread board Host Operating System e g WIN 2000 Version build e g Service Pack 4 5 4 Tools OCD Dongle Firmware Version KEIL Add about windows screen shot in attachment ISP Software musi...

Page 29: ...Atmel Operations 2325 Orchard Parkway San Jose CA 95131 Tel 1 408 441 0311 Fax 1 408 487 2600 Regional Headquarters Europe Atmel Sarl Route des Arsenaux 41 Case Postale 80 CH 1705 Fribourg Switzerland Tel 41 26 426 5555 Fax 41 26 426 5500 Asia Room 1219 Chinachem Golden Plaza 77 Mody Road Tsimshatsui East Kowloon Hong Kong Tel 852 2721 9778 Fax 852 2722 1369 Japan 9F Tonetsu Shinkawa Bldg 1 24 8 S...

Reviews: